Daftar Isi
Mengenal MongoDB Database Nosql adalah langkah awal yang sangat krusial bagi siapa saja yang membangun software inovatif yang memiliki efisiensi tinggi. Dalam dunia pengembangan perangkat lunak, pilihan basis data berperan fungsi krusial dalam kelancaran proyek. Mongodb, selaku salah satu di antara basis data NoSQL terpopuler, menawarkan fleksibilitas dan kemampuan untuk berkembang yang sangat dibutuhkan dalam big data saat ini. Dengan format dokumen yang intuitive serta kapasitas untuk memproses berbagai jenis data, Memahami MongoDB Basis Data Nosql bisa menjadi jawaban sempurna untuk memenuhi bisnis Anda.
Untuk developer dan owner proyek, Mengenal Mongodb Database NoSQL tidak hanya tentang teknologi, melainkan tentang cara teknologi tersebut dapat merubah metode Anda berinteraksi dengan informasi. MongoDB menyediakan kemudahan dalam penyimpanan dan pengambilan data, yang mana mempercepatkan periode development. Dengan adanya struktur yang menunjang distribusi data dan kapasitas untuk menangani beban kerja yang besar, wajar jika memang Mongodb adalah pilihan favorit bagi perusahaan-perusahaan yang ingin meraih keunggulan kompetitif di pasaran.
Manfaat database MongoDB daripada basis data relational
Keunggulan Mongo DB dibanding database relasional sangat jelas khususnya dalam aspek kelenturan struktur data. Memahami MongoDB database non-SQL memberikan pemahaman bahwasanya penyimpanan informasi tak terikat oleh skema yang rigid, seperti apa yang sering ditemukan dalam basis data relasi. Ini ini memfasilitasi user agar bisa menempatkan data ke dalam bentuk file yang bisa dengan mudah disesuaikan sesuai dengan kebutuhan aplikasi, menjadikannya sebagai pilihan ideaal bagi pengembang yang bekerja menggunakan informasi yang bervariasi serta dinamis.
Selain itu, MongoDB juga menawarkan performa yang lebih baik terkait penanganan big data serta transaksi yang cepat. Memahami MongoDB berarti memahami cara data dapat diakses serta dimanipulasi dengan lebih efisien, khususnya untuk program yang memerlukan kecepatan tinggi. Kecepatan tambahannya dalam pengambilan dan penulisan data menjadikan basis data ini sebagai solusi yang sangat menarik untuk sistem skala besar dan aplikasi yang memerlukan real-time.
Akhirnya, kemampuan skala horizontal yang ditawarkan oleh MongoDB memperkuat posisinya dibandingkan dengan database relasional. Dengan MongoDB basis data NoSQL, kamu akan menemukan bahwa tahapan penambahan kapasitas penyimpanan bisa dilaksanakan dengan lebih mudah melalui sharding, yang merupakan pembagian data menjadi beberapa bagian yang lebih ringkas. Kelebihan ini memungkinkan aplikasi untuk tumbuh sesuai permintaan tanpa menjalani penurunan performa, berbeda dengan basis data relasional yang sering mengharuskan peningkatan perangkat keras yang lebih rumit.
Kasus Penerapan Ideal bagi MongoDB
Mengenal Mongodb Database Nosql menawarkan berbagai keuntungan dalam hal penyimpanan serta manajemen data. Salah satu kasus penggunaan ideal untuk MongoDB merupakan dalam aplikasi yang memerlukan butuh kapasitas besar dan kemudahan terkait jenis data yang dapat disimpan. Melalui rangka informasi berdasarkan dokumen, MongoDB mengizinkan developer agar menyimpan data dalam format bentuk JSON, yang sangat sesuai bagi aplikasi situs kontemporer yang seringkali kerap menangani informasi yang tidak tidak maupun semi-struktur. Situasi ini membuat MongoDB pilihan utama untuk banyak developer dalam proses pengembangan aplikasi yang dengan cepat beradaptasi dengan pergeseran kebutuhan usaha.
Selanjutnya, Memahami MongoDB Basis Data NoSQL sangat amat bermanfaat untuk pengembangan aplikasi program waktu nyata seperti analisis data dan serta pengumpulan data informasi dari pengguna. Basis Data MongoDB memiliki kemampuan untuk menangani beban yang tinggi dengan tinggi, dengan cepat distribusi data nya. Kasus penggunaan ini amat sesuai untuk aplikasi yang memerlukan pengolahan data, contohnya dashboard analitik atau aplikasi sosial aplikasi sosial yang butuh respons yang yang. Dengan menggunakan MongoDB developer dapat dengan mudah memperbarui data secara simultan tanpa harus khawatir khawatir tentang gangguan kinerja program.
Terakhir, Mengenal Mongodb Basis Data NoSQL sangat relevan dalam konteks internet benda (internet benda) dan aplikasi mobile. Di dunia IoT, ribuan perangkat yg menghimpun serta mengirimkan informasi mengharuskan alternatif basis data yg sanggup menampung informasi dengan volume yang banyak dan beragam. Database MongoDB menawarkan kemampuan manipulasi informasi yang kompatibel dengan kebutuhan harapan tersebut, memungkinkan aplikasi seluler agar mendapatkan dan mengelola informasi dari aneka macam secara yang efisien. Dengan karakteristik yang meliputi sharding serta replikasi, MongoDB membangun ekosistem basis data yang skalabel dan terpercaya untuk menunjang lonjakan dan inovasi pada proyek IoT serta aplikasi mobile.
Tips Memasuki menggunakan MongoDB dalam Karya Anda
Memahami MongoDB Database NoSQL adalah fase awal yang penting sebelum Anda menjalankan proyek Anda. Dengan sistem manajemen basis database yang terdasarkan dokumen, MongoDB menyediakan kemudahan dan skalabilitas yang luar biasa, maka menjadikannya sebagai pilihan tepat untuk ragam jenis program. Dengan cara memahami bagaimana MongoDB menyimpan data dalam format mirip JSON, Anda bisa mengembangkan struktur yang lebih efisien dan cocok dengan kebutuhan proyek Anda. Menyadari cara fungsi MongoDB Database akan mempermudah Anda dalam mengambil keputusan yang lebih bijak dalam hal menangani data.
Sesudah memahami MongoDB Database NoSQL, tahap berikutnya adalah mempelajari cara menginstalnya dan mengonfigurasinya. MongoDB memberikan panduan step-by-step yang dapat membantu Anda memasang database ini di banyak sistem operasi. Di samping itu, Anda juga sebaiknya memahami alat-alat yang ada oleh MongoDB, seperti Compass untuk visualisasi data dan MongoDB Shell sebagai interaksi langsung dengan database. Dengan menggunakan tools ini, Anda bisa mempercepatkan proses development dan membantu penelusuran kesalahan dalam proyek Anda.
Terakhir, praktikkan penerapan MongoDB Basis Data NoSQL melalui membangun proyek kecil. Awali dari merancang struktur database yang mudah, lalu manfaatkan operasi CRUD (Buat, Baca, Perbarui, Delete) dalam rangka mengelola informasi. Inisiatif sederhana ini memberikan pemahaman praktis tentang cara kerja MongoDB dan memudahkan Anda mengetahui banyak kemampuan yang bisa berguna dalam proyek yang lebih kompleks. Melalui pengalaman praktis dalam menggunakan MongoDB, Anda akan lebih yakin dalam memanfaatkannya dalam Anda serta bersiap menghadapi tantangan yang mungkin muncul.